A Healthy Apple And Celery Soup
- 8 large apples, peeled and rough chopped (I used McIntosh, you can use whatever, you just don't want a tart apple)
- 2 cups celery, rough chopped
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 4 tablespoons butter
- 1 medium onion, rough chopped
- 1 tablespoon fresh sage, very fine chopped
- 1 pinch clove
- ground black pepper
- Brandied Mascarpone
- 1 1/2 cups mascarpone
- 2 ounces brandy
- Base -- In a medium sauce pan, melt the butter over medium heat and add the celery, onion and cook 3-4 minutes. Add in the apples and broth and cook until tender. It will take about 20 minutes on a medium low simmer, uncovered.
- Puree -- I used my immersion blender, but you can you can transfer it to a standard blender and puree until smooth.
- Season -- Add in the the sage, and a very small pinch of cloves, go easy ad season with black pepper. Cook another 10 minutes.
- Mascarpone -- Mix the mascarpone with the brandy, and return to the refrigerator. I mixed mine right in the container, save on those dirty dishes.
- Serve -- I like to serve with a fresh small sprig of sage and a dollop of the Brandied Mascarpone cheese. You can serve this hot, which I prefer, or chilled is also very good. And don't forget my Sweet Savory Bread Sticks.
